How do you get the answer to 2(3-1)-4(-1-1) using order of operations

Answer:

12

Step-by-step explanation:

Order of operations is known as BEDMAS, PEDMAS, PEMDAS or some other variants but they are all essentially the same.

The first step we must complete is anything in brackets or parenthesis.

2(3-1)-4(-1-1) = 2(2)-4(-2)

Second step is exponents, but there are no exponents in this question so we skip this step.

Third step is multiplication and/or division.

2(2)-4(-2) = 4 + 8

The final step is addition and/or subtraction.

4 + 8 = 12
